Local Regulations and Guidelines
The first step in determining the appropriate distance for your septic tank is to consult local regulations. Each state or municipality may have specific codes that dictate the minimum distance required between a septic tank and various structures, including your home. Common regulations include:
- Minimum distance from the house: Typically ranges from 5 to 10 feet.
- Distance from water sources: Must be a minimum of 50 to 100 feet from wells, lakes, or streams.
- Separation from property lines: Often requires a distance of at least 5 feet.
Failing to adhere to these regulations can lead to fines, forced removal of the system, or even legal issues if contamination occurs.

Plumbing Layout
The layout of your plumbing system is another critical factor in determining the distance between your septic tank and your house. The plumbing design will influence the slope of the pipes, which should ideally be a minimum of 1/4 inch per foot to ensure proper flow. Considerations include:
- Location of bathrooms and kitchen: The closer these are to the septic tank, the easier it will be to manage wastewater.
- Pipe length: Longer pipes can lead to clogs and require more maintenance.
- Access for maintenance: Ensure that the tank is accessible for pumping and inspections.
A well-planned plumbing layout can minimize the distance while maximizing efficiency.

Regular Inspections and Maintenance
Once your septic tank is installed, regular maintenance is crucial for its longevity. Follow these recommendations:
- Schedule pumping every 3-5 years, depending on usage and tank size.
- Inspect the tank annually for signs of leaks or damage.
- Keep records of maintenance and inspections for future reference.
Regular maintenance can save you from costly repairs and extend the life of your septic system.
